本篇将深入浅出地解释数据库常用名词,揭开数据世界的神秘面纱。涵盖数据库、表、行、列、索引等核心概念,助您轻松步入数据管理的殿堂。
本文目录导读:
图片来源于网络,如有侵权联系删除
数据库
数据库(Database)是存储、管理和检索数据的集合,它是计算机科学中的一个重要领域,广泛应用于各个行业,数据库可以存储大量的数据,并允许用户进行数据的查询、更新、删除等操作。
数据库管理系统(DBMS)
数据库管理系统(Database Management System,简称DBMS)是用于创建、维护、查询和更新数据库的一组软件,它为用户提供了数据存储、检索、更新和管理等功能,常见的数据库管理系统有MySQL、Oracle、SQL Server等。
数据库模型
数据库模型是数据库系统的逻辑结构和数据组织方式,常见的数据库模型有:
1、层次模型:以树形结构表示实体及其联系,适用于表示具有一对多关系的实体。
2、网状模型:以图结构表示实体及其联系,适用于表示具有多对多关系的实体。
3、关系模型:以表格形式表示实体及其联系,是目前应用最广泛的数据库模型。
数据表(Table)
数据表是数据库中存储数据的结构,每个数据表由行和列组成,行表示数据记录,列表示数据字段,数据表是关系模型中存储数据的基本单位。
字段(Field)
字段是数据表中的一个列,用于存储特定类型的数据,姓名、年龄、电话等都是数据表中的字段。
记录(Record)
记录是数据表中的一行,表示一个具体的数据实体,在学生数据表中,每行数据代表一个学生的信息。
图片来源于网络,如有侵权联系删除
主键(Primary Key)
主键是数据表中唯一标识每条记录的字段,在关系型数据库中,每个表都必须有一个主键,主键可以是单个字段,也可以是多个字段的组合。
外键(Foreign Key)
外键是用于建立两个表之间联系的字段,外键在一个表中指向另一个表的主键,通过外键,可以保证数据的一致性和完整性。
索引(Index)
索引是数据库中用于加速数据检索的数据结构,它类似于书的目录,可以帮助快速找到所需的数据,常见的索引类型有:
1、单一索引:对单个字段建立索引。
2、复合索引:对多个字段建立索引。
3、倒排索引:对文本字段建立索引,用于全文检索。
视图(View)
视图是数据库中的一种虚拟表,它基于一个或多个表的数据动态生成,视图可以简化复杂的查询操作,提高数据的安全性。
十一、触发器(Trigger)
触发器是数据库中的一种特殊类型的存储过程,它在满足特定条件时自动执行,触发器常用于实现数据的完整性约束、自动计算字段值等。
图片来源于网络,如有侵权联系删除
十二、存储过程(Stored Procedure)
存储过程是一组为了完成特定任务而预编译好的SQL语句集合,它可以提高数据库的执行效率,减少网络传输的数据量。
十三、事务(Transaction)
事务是数据库中一系列操作的总和,它具有原子性、一致性、隔离性和持久性(ACID)特点,事务确保了数据库操作的可靠性和一致性。
十四、锁(Lock)
锁是数据库管理系统用于控制并发访问的一种机制,通过锁,可以防止多个用户同时修改同一数据,保证数据的一致性和完整性。
数据库常用名词涵盖了数据库的各个方面,了解这些名词有助于我们更好地理解和应用数据库技术,在学习和使用数据库的过程中,不断积累和总结,将有助于我们成为数据库领域的专家。
评论列表